<p class="text-gray-700">[player_tooltip player_id='1765516' first='Marach' last='Dau'] has all the tools you look for in a big man parlayed with great hustle and fluidity. Defensively, Marach was one of the most impactful players at this event. His great length and discipline under the rim, not biting on pump fakes, made him impossible to score on in the paint. As a help defender, he was dominant, swatting away shots and shutting off the rim with his great ability to recover. His footwork on this end was also immaculate, he guarded very well on the perimeter, poking away dribbles, shuting off drives, and getting in passing lanes. Offensively, Marach was also a problem for opposing defenses. He springs off the floor at a moment's notice, which led to many dunks off drop-off passes from driving teammates as well as lobs that he snatched from the top shelf, and finished with power. Marach showed the ability to create his own shot in the post as well. Using his soft touch, steady handle, and great size. [player_tooltip player_id='1765516' first='Marach' last='Dau'] shows elite potential, and with how hard he plays, I have no doubt he will reach it.</p>

<p class="text-gray-700">[player_tooltip player_id='1978110' first='Jaishon' last='White'] is all you want in a lead guard. His ball handling is special, and he used his repertoire of moves to break down defenders one-on-one and get to the rim. He was an absolute wrecking ball down low, using his solid frame and broad shoulders to carve out space for crafty finishes with his great touch. Jaishon was also very balanced whenever he was driving, getting low and exploding, but then rising into mid-range jumpers with ease. Jaishon was also extremely valuable as a rebounder and passer. Jaishon used his eyes to manipulate defenders and find open looks for cutters, as well as kicking out to shooters when defenders would collapse in on his drives. Jaishon also had great showings as a defender. Using his quick hands to rip ball handlers and shutting down drives with his solid frame. Overall, [player_tooltip player_id='1978110' first='Jaishon' last='White'] can do a little bit of everything at a high level. He is the definition of versatile. </p>

<p class="text-gray-700">Gio Quiles showed his high-level offensive feel at June Jam. Gio was extremely smart and patient under the rim. He used pump fakes and hop steps to create open looks for himself down low, and converted on these shots at a high clip. Gio showed that he is a decisive driver and scorer, using his shoulders to bump off defenders and get rim finishes or pull-up mid-range buckets. Gio was also very active on the boards throughout this event, and showed his great ability to be a decision maker in an offense, making great reads and finding many open teammates with timely passes. Gio Quiles was always making the right play at June Jam, and that is where he thrives. </p>

<p class="text-gray-700">[player_tooltip player_id='1907683' first='Hunter' last='Horn'] at June Jam showed that he is the ultimate energy guy. On Defense, Hunter was all over the place, guarding every position and locking them up, allowing no penetration and tallying steals with his great size, speed, and footwork. Hunter never looked tired out there and was always hustling and engaged. One opponent had an easy fast break lay up and Hunter ran back with all his might and smacked it off the glass, showing his determination. On offense, Hunter was also the perfect glue guy, always giving his teammates options in the flow of the offense with his smart cuts. As well as being a great connective passer and rebounder. He showed some bounce also, getting up for emphatic dunks. [player_tooltip player_id='1907683' first='Hunter' last='Horn'] showed at June Jam that he can fit on any team with his nonstop hustle and crafty off-ball instincts. </p>
